5. Telegram From the Central Intelligence Agency to the CIA Station in [place not declassified]1

24629. 1. Hq. desires firm list top flight Communists whom new government would desire to eliminate immediately in event of successful anti-Communist coup.2

2. Request you verify following list and recommend additions or deletions: [5–1/2 lines of source text not declassified].

  1. Source: Central Intelligence Agency, Job 79–01025A, Box 145, Folder 12. Secret; Priority; [codeword not declassified]. A similar telegram was dispatched on January 29. (Ibid.)
  2. In a January 29 response the Chief of Station suggested additional names and noted: “Cannot say all on list are commies but their leanings are such that considered dangerous our interests. … Minimum action of arrest and deportation all on [text not declassified] list should be a new government’s desire. Consider doubtful new govt. could long control without deportation majority on list.” (Telegram to CIA Station in [place not declassified] January 29; ibid., Box 7, Folder 1)
